рекомендации для дат последнего изменения и создания


У меня есть веб-сайт с несколькими (в настоящее время 3; я ожидаю, что их будет около дюжины, когда он будет завершен) статическими html-страницами. Я хотел бы включить даты "созданных" и "последних изменений" на страницах в интересах посетителей, которые прибудут через неделю, месяц или несколько лет. Я ожидаю, что все, кому не все равно, будут просматривать источник, поэтому я мог бы сделать:

<!-- created yyyy-mm-dd, last-modified yyyy-mm-dd -->

Но я хотел бы использовать что-то более стандартное (и элегантное). Я нашел одну ссылку на последнее изменение (но только упоминание в тексте, а не фактическая ссылка на код, поэтому я не уверен, как правильно его реализовать), но не создан.

Существует ли правильный способ отображения обеих (или хотя бы одной) из этих дат?

Author: Jukka K. Korpela, 2012-11-29

2 answers

Создано 29 ноября 2012 года. Последнее изменение 1 декабря 2012 года.

Альтернативно:

Создано 2012-11-29. Последнее изменение 2012-12-01.

Попытка использовать для этого автоматизированные процессы в случае трех статических страниц, которые, вероятно, будут изменяться примерно раз в год, действительно была бы излишней. Это также было бы чревато ошибками. Большинство "последних измененных" сценариев используют в качестве основы последний доступ на запись к файлу. Это означает, среди прочего, что если вы откроете файл, отредактируете его, а затем удалите редактирование, оно будет отображаться как измененное, когда его не было.

 1
Author: Jukka K. Korpela, 2012-11-29 09:08:25

Поскольку все они являются статическими HTML-страницами, вы должны создать серверную часть. Один HTML-файл, который включен во все остальные HTML-файлы. Теперь, после того как вы обновите свои веб-сайты, вам нужно будет обновить только этот один HTML-файл и написать Последнее обновление 29.11.2012, и оно появится на всех страницах. Вы можете разместить включенный HTML-файл в нижнем колонтитуле, что довольно распространено. В любом месте, хотя на самом деле это зависит от вас, это просто простой способ управления статическими HTML-файлами с помощью серверной части включать.

 0
Author: Anagio, 2012-11-29 08:10:13